- Liquid chromatographic determination of lumacaftor in the presence of ivacaftor and identification of five novel degradation products using high-performance liquid chromatography ion trap time-of-flight mass spectrometry.: This study demonstrates the use of high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) with ion trap time-of-flight mass spectrometry for the determination of lumacaftor in the presence of ivacaftor. The research identifies five novel degradation products, showcasing the advanced analytical capabilities of the Ascentis® Express F5, 2.7 µm HPLC Column for complex mixtures and degradation studies (Özcan et al., 2023).
- Stability-indicating LC-MS/MS and LC-DAD methods for robust determination of tasimelteon and high resolution mass spectrometric identification of a novel degradation product.: This paper details the development of stability-indicating methods using LC-MS/MS and LC-DAD for the determination of tasimelteon. It highlights the robustness and sensitivity of these methods in identifying novel degradation products, with the Ascentis® Express F5 column playing a crucial role in separation efficiency and stability analysis (Özcan et al., 2020).
- Recent trends in ultra-fast HPLC: new generation superficially porous silica columns.: This review article discusses recent advancements in ultra-fast HPLC, focusing on new generation superficially porous silica columns, including the Ascentis® Express F5, 2.7 µm HPLC Column. It provides insights into the enhanced performance, speed, and efficiency of these columns in high-throughput analytical applications (Ali et al., 2012).
